In this contribution, the design and the experimental results of a power amplifier in LDMOS technology are reported. The amplifier has been designed to operate at 2.14GHz and exploiting the output second harmonic to boost the obtainable performances. The measurement results shown an output power of 39 dBm and a drain efficiency greater than 50% at 2.1 GHz.
